Two NIFT Officials Booked For Caste Discrimination In Chennai

Chennai: Two top officials of National Institute of Fashion Technology (NIFT), a premier institute offering fashion education, were booked for practicing caste-based discrimination against a senior official from a Dalit community on Wednesday. The FIR was filed on May 8 based on the complaint of K Ilanchezhian, a senior assistant director of NIFT under the Union Textiles Ministry.

The action was taken on Wednesday since Ilanchezhian got access to the copy of the complaint from the police website on Tuesday.

According to a report on The New Indian Express, the FIR said, the director of the institute Anitha Mabel Manohar humiliated the victim by shifting his office from the main building to a room in the student's hostel. She also allotted the office space to a junior researcher who belonged to a dominant case.

Following this, Illanchezhian was informed about the discrimination of the higher-ups in Delhi and they ordered to shift him back to his room. However, Anitha reportedly refused to follow the order and issued another order to ensure that he stayed in the hostel, said the report.

Apart from Anitha, the FIR has also named the joint director of the institute B Narasimhan. Both of the officials of NIFT have been booked under various sections of S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ities) Act, 1989.

Further, the FIR also said that the victim was targeted by the accused from September 2020 to March 2022.

In 2020, Anitha also reportedly filed a complaint against Ilanchezhian with Internal Complaints Committee. However, the ICC in February 2022 had communicated to Anitha that the complaint does not fall under their purview.
